Nine homes gutted after gunmen open fire, torch houses in Naga village in Manipur's Kangpokpi

An armed group opened fire and then set several houses ablaze in a Naga village in Manipur's Kangpokpi district late Tuesday night, with reliable sources putting the toll at nine houses completely destroyed.

A Naga village in Manipur's Kangpokpi district came under attack late Tuesday night when an armed group fired multiple rounds and then set fire to several homes, officials confirmed on Wednesday.

Gunfire Then Flames Near Midnight

The assault unfolded around 10 pm at Tokpa Liangmai Naga village, situated close to Tumnoupokpi Thangal village. Witnesses and officials said the attackers first fired several rounds before turning to arson, torching a number of houses in the settlement.

Toll Still Being Confirmed, Nine Houses Said Gutted

A precise count of destroyed homes has yet to be finalised, officials said, partly because most structures in the village are kutcha houses that burn down quickly and leave little to survey. Even so, reliable sources put the number of completely gutted houses at nine. Investigators have not yet established a motive, and the identities of those behind the attack remain unknown.

Frightened Residents Seek Protection

The attack has left villagers shaken, and residents have appealed to the authorities to open an immediate investigation and put in place measures to guarantee their safety going forward.

Silence From Administration And Police

As of Wednesday morning, neither the Kangpokpi district administration, the Manipur Police nor security forces had issued any official statement on the incident.

Another Flashpoint Amid Ongoing Unrest

The latest violence comes against a backdrop of persistent tension across several parts of Manipur, where repeated attacks by armed groups on villages have kept security concerns high. Just two days earlier, on Monday, at least three residential houses were set ablaze in Kailenjang Kuki village, also in Kangpokpi district. Police said that incident occurred around 1:30 pm at Kailenjang village, located roughly 5 km west of the Senapati police station.
